- Prince Salman bin Sultan inaugurates Khair Al-Khalq Museum showcasing prophetic teachings through modern technology
MADINAH: Prince Salman bin Sultan, governor of Madinah and chairman of the Madinah Development Authority, has opened the Khair Al-Khalq (Best of Creation) Museum at the As Safiyyah Museum and Park building south of the Prophet’s Mosque.
The museum is a pioneering educational destination that combines knowledge and technology, the Saudi Press Agency reported on Monday.
During a tour of the museum, Prince Salman viewed exhibits and technologies that bring to life aspects of the life of Prophet Muhammad, and watched several audiovisual presentations.
During the opening ceremony, attendees watched a presentation on the museum, followed by a speech by Fawaz Almehrij, CEO of Samaya Investment Co.
Almehrij said the museum offers a modern educational experience that enables visitors to explore history through a contemporary lens and learn about the values of prophethood.
He thanked Prince Salman for his support of cultural initiatives and efforts to develop Madinah and enhance the community’s quality of life.
Almehrij also thanked Madinah Mayor and CEO of the Madinah Development Authority Fahad Albulihshi for overseeing the project, and ensuring it serves as a cultural landmark that enriches the experience of visitors to the Prophet’s Mosque.
Earlier this year, Prince Salman also inaugurated the “Ala Khutah” (“In His Footsteps”) project, which allows visitors to trace the prophet’s migration route from Makkah to Madinah.
The project highlights the historical significance of the event, promotes awareness of the prophet’s biography, and supports sustainable cultural and economic development along the route.
Prince Salman emphasized that the project reflects the Kingdom’s leadership in serving the holy sites and enhancing the experience of visitors and pilgrims.
He noted that it integrates faith, knowledge and development, showcasing Islam’s values of justice, mercy, tolerance, and coexistence, and reinforcing the Kingdom’s role as the heart of the Islamic world.
